dc.description.abstractIn vitro shoot and root regeneration of 2-year-old Nothofagus alpina plants was achieved from several types of explants cultured in vitro on a modified Woody Plant Medium formulation. Multiple shoot formation was obtained from leaf explants using 0.45-2.27 mu M thidiazuron and 0.0049-0.098 mu M indolebutyric acid. Excised axillary buds formed shoots and roots in the presence of 0.0049 mu M benzyladenine and 2.46 mu M indolebutyric acid, or in the absence of plant growth regulators. Nodal sections rooted when 2.46 mu M indole butyric acid at was supplied in the medium. Subcultured shoots originating from nodal sections showed a high regeneration rate through multiple shoot and root formation.
